# Fair Market Opportunity

<div><figure><img src="/files/5LCqDhKPs3H84OTm50Fe" alt=""><figcaption><p>#1 GPU Manufacturer</p></figcaption></figure> <figure><img src="/files/EiCwf7M9jAk6zOi8geLE" alt=""><figcaption><p>#2 GPU Manufacturer</p></figcaption></figure></div>

The largest GPU manufacturers, such as NVIDIA and AMD, are creating a fair market opportunity to promote the decentralization of GPU distribution by limiting order sizes per company regardless of how much money you have. So, a startup will be able to order GPUs even amongst the competing multi-billion dollar corporations.

Our supply chain has been tested by taking delivery of our first order GPUs and can currently fulfill orders up to $3,000,000.00 (USD) in GPUs per month with options to increase volume to meet our growing demand as we are now entering the scaling phase of the business.
